And this is the part most people miss: Zelensky’s public demeanor with Trump often appears deferential, but behind closed doors, he’s firmly advocating for Ukraine’s non-negotiable red lines, like refusing to relinquish control of the Donbas region.

In a Fox News interview, Zelensky clarified that while 87% of Ukrainians support peace, 85% oppose withdrawing from the Donbas. This raises a critical question: Can a peace deal that sacrifices Ukrainian territory ever be considered just? Ukrainian lawmakers, like Kira Rudik of the Holos party, vehemently reject such compromises. Rudik bluntly stated, ‘Peace cannot come at the cost of abandoning our fellow citizens.’

Trump’s suggestion of addressing the Ukrainian parliament, as he did the Israeli Knesset, seems unlikely given his tone-deaf remarks. The Mar-a-Lago talks, despite claims of progress, revealed little movement. Ukraine’s territorial integrity remains a sticking point, and Putin shows no signs of halting his bombardment. But here’s where it gets controversial: Some analysts argue that Russia’s baseless accusation of a Ukrainian drone strike on Putin’s residence was a deliberate attempt to derail peace talks, suggesting Moscow fears U.S.-Ukraine negotiations are gaining traction.

Former U.S. diplomat Daniel Fried hinted at this, tweeting, ‘The U.S. and Ukraine seem to be closing in on a peace framework. So the Kremlin tries to derail it.’ Yet, Doug Klain of Razom For Ukraine warns that Trump’s pro-Putin rhetoric only emboldens Russia, removing any pressure for Moscow to negotiate in good faith.
